Case Summary: SLP(Crl) No. 001008-001009/2001 On 02/03/2001, the Supreme Court (Justices K.T. Thomas and R.P. Sethi) heard Veena Venkatesh's Special Leave Petition against M.V. Krishna Murthy, challenging a Karnataka High Court order dated 06/09/2000. The Court condoned the delay in filing the petition but dismissed the Special Leave Petitions on merits, upholding the High Court's decision.
